What Is an Emergency Custody Order?
An emergency custody order is a temporary legal arrangement that grants someone custody of a child quickly, often without the usual extended court process. In Detroit, these orders are designed to respond promptly when a child's safety or well-being is at immediate risk.
When Should You Consider Seeking an Emergency Custody Order?
Situations that might call for an emergency custody order include concerns about a child's safety due to neglect, abuse, or other urgent family circumstances. If there's a sudden change that affects the child's living environment or care, an emergency order can help provide stability while longer-term arrangements are considered.
Understanding the Process in Detroit
Filing for an emergency custody order typically involves submitting a petition to the family court explaining the urgent need for custody. The court reviews the request and may hold a hearing to decide whether to grant the order. Because these orders are temporary, they often last only until a full custody hearing can be scheduled.
Keep in mind that local court procedures and requirements can vary, so it is important to check with the Detroit family court or a trusted local resource for specific details.

Frequently Asked Questions
- How quickly can an emergency custody order be granted in Detroit?
The timing can depend on the court’s schedule and the urgency of the situation. Emergency orders are intended to be processed faster than regular custody cases, but exact wait times vary. - Can both parents request an emergency custody order?
Yes, either parent, or sometimes another person with a significant relationship to the child, can petition for an emergency custody order if there are urgent safety concerns. - Does an emergency custody order affect long-term custody decisions?
Emergency orders are temporary and do not determine permanent custody arrangements. They provide protection until a full hearing can address long-term custody. - What if the other parent disagrees with the emergency custody order?
The other parent usually has the right to be notified and to attend hearings, where they can present their side before a judge decides. - Are emergency custody orders available outside of regular court hours?
Some courts have provisions for after-hours emergencies, but availability can vary. It’s important to check local court resources. - Can I get help filing for an emergency custody order in Detroit?
Legal aid organizations and family support services may offer assistance with filing and understanding the process.
